The Showering Lotus

Endearing the gods of enlightenment, dip tenderly into the rainbows Color band of intrinsic light, softly breathing, as the hushed breath of A morning doves first coo of life, the lotus flower does blossom and bloom. Infusions delicate creation floating in the still pond of the everlasting, Drifting, swaying at the mercy of life's strife, yet in harmonious peace Its beauty remains perfections timeless jewel, sparkling beneath the mid-eastern Sun. Bending does the reddest rose, yielding it's petals to the keepsakes heart Most sacred inner place, a whirl winds tidal storm of emotions contemplation Point of origin, it bleeds with a crimson preciousness, Tangled are the vines woven to and fro, but rich is the human soul. Floating, cascading cherry blossom's dance, amongst the winds of Destiny's air, ever gently whispering of loves softness, comforting warmth Within the arms of lovers devotional vows. These are the delicate tokens of the for-get-me-knots, showering of the Lotus, a blending emergence, behold the feminine Oh let the captive sparrow sing so softly the notes of spring, let her soar Amongst the eternal skies of white clouds beneath liberation's whitest Wings of grace. Upwards, lifted upwards to touch and caress the distant sun above, Little bird spread your delicate appendages, lie thy offering of the lotus Leaf before the divine, and may it appease the God's, from which it draws Life itself from be thy finest gift ever sacrificed, Tender are their tears are shed, for she the sparrow of mortality. Exhalted amongst the stars in the very heavens on high, A beauty figure thus stands, poring the water of life into the deep Rivers of the universe, and behind her ear lies a lotus blossom. That blooms eternal. BY: CHERYL ANNA DUNN
